cryobry 5 years ago
parent
commit
04536cd5ad
1 changed files with 14 additions and 5 deletions
  1. 14 5
      nba_playoffs_game_updater.py

+ 14 - 5
nba_playoffs_game_updater.py

@@ -13,7 +13,6 @@ import timeout_decorator
 
 _spreadsheetKey = "12Zv95ZMJ008KXC5ytVnBusjX9wUnpOg0TOLwmxMNOTQ"
 
-####### GET SHEETS AND NUM PARTICIPANTS #######
 
 def _getStatsSheet(_key):
   scope = ['https://spreadsheets.google.com/feeds',
@@ -33,14 +32,22 @@ def _getStatsSheet(_key):
   # count participants
   _numParticipants = _leaderSheet.row_count - 1
 
-  return _statsSheet, _numParticipants
+  return _statsSheet, _leaderSheet
   
+  
+def _getNumParticipants(_leaderSheet):
 
-def _getRowsFromDate(_statsSheet, _numParticipants):
+  _numParticipants = _leaderSheet.row_count - 1
+  
+  return _numParticipants
   
+
+def _getRowsFromDate(_statsSheet, _numParticipants):
+
   # get today
   _today = datetime.date.today()
-  #_today = datetime.date(2018, 5, 2)
+  # else manually set the date
+  #_today = datetime.date(2018, 5, 16)
   
   _urlDate = _today.strftime('%m/%d/%Y')
 
@@ -88,6 +95,7 @@ def _getPlayerFirstNameLastName(_player):
   _firstName = _firstNamelastName[0]
   _firstName = _firstName.replace('.', '')
   _lastName = _firstNamelastName[1]
+  
   return _firstName, _lastName
   
 
@@ -144,7 +152,8 @@ def _badName(_statsSheet, _playerCell):
 while True:
 
   try:
-    _statsSheet, _numParticipants = _getStatsSheet(_spreadsheetKey)
+    _statsSheet, _leaderSheet = _getStatsSheet(_spreadsheetKey)
+    _numParticipants = _getNumParticipants(_leaderSheet)
     _startRow, _lastRow, _urlDate = _getRowsFromDate(_statsSheet, _numParticipants)
     if _startRow == 0:
       print("No games today! Pausing for 1000s")